Thunder has won 11 of the last 12 games

Ponca City Now - December 11, 2013 6:47 am

ATLANTA (AP) – Kevin Durant scored 30 points and the Oklahoma City Thunder won for the 11th time in 12 games, holding off the Atlanta Hawks 101-92 last night. Russell Westbrook was held to 14 points on 6-of-21 shooting, though he did sink an impressive reverse layup with 1:41 remaining to help finish off Atlanta. Durant made 9 of 21 from the field and 11 of 15 free throws.
